How they compare

Republic of Korea currently reports 0.0016 kt against 0.0013 kt in Switzerland, a difference of 0.0003 kt.

That makes Republic of Korea's figure about 1.2 times Switzerland's.

The two have swapped places 14 times across 65 shared years of data; in 1961 it was Republic of Korea ahead.

Republic of Korea ranks 116th and Switzerland ranks 119th of 168 countries.

Across the 9 decades both report, Republic of Korea averaged higher in 7 and Switzerland in 2.

The FAOSTAT domain on Emissions from Crops provides estimates of emissions associated with crop processes, namely 1) crop residues, 2) burning of crop residues, and 3) rice cultivation and the application of nitrogen (N) fertilizers, including mineral and chemical fertilizers, to soils. Estimates are computed at Tier 1 following the 2006 IPCC Guidelines for National greenhouse gas (GHG) Inventories (IPCC, 2006).
